Inclusion Criteria
Inclusion Criteria: Patients in the range of 18 to 65 years old; Osteoarthritis diagnosed by MRI
Exclusion Criteria
Pregnancy or lactating; Positive tests for HIV, HCV, HBV; Active neurologic disorder; End organ damage; History/active malignancy; Uncontrolled endocrine disorder; Active respiratory disorder/reaction to sedation drugs; History of cancer

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Function improvement. Timepoint: 3,6,12 and 30 months after transplantation. Method of measurement: WOMAC osteoarthritis index.;Pain density. Timepoint: 3,6,12 and 30 months after transplantation. Method of measurement: Visual Analogue Scale.
- Secondary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Joint function. Timepoint: 6,12 and 30 months after transplantation. Method of measurement: Physical examination, VAS, womac.;Allergic reactions. Timepoint: 3,6,12and 30 month after transplantation. Method of measurement: Physical examination.;Neoplastic changes. Timepoint: 6,12 and 30 months after transplantation. Method of measurement: MRI.;Cartilage thickness. Timepoint: 6,12 and 30 months after transplantation. Method of measurement: MRI.;Subchondral edema. Timepoint: 6,12 and 30 months after transplantation. Method of measurement: MRI.
